Victor Wembanyama's Kung Fu Training
Victor Wembanyama, the San Antonio Spurs' standout, has been turning heads with his unconventional training methods. After a 10-day stay at a Shaolin temple in Zhengzhou, China, Wembanyama believes his kung fu training has significantly improved his mental focus and body positioning on the court. His return to the court was marked by a dominant performance in the Spurs' 111-70 victory over the Philadelphia 76ers.
Yang Hansen's Impressive Debut
Yang Hansen, the 7-foot-2 center drafted by the Portland Trail Blazers, has quickly made an impact with his skill level, particularly his passing. Despite concerns about his ability to handle the NBA's pace, Hansen's performance has justified the Trail Blazers' decision to draft him. His development will be closely watched as he adapts to the league.
Future NBA Draft Concerns
NBA executives are already expressing concerns about the 2027 draft class, which appears to lack the star power of previous years. This has led to increased focus on the 2026 draft, which features several high-profile prospects. The upcoming FIBA U18 EuroBasket tournament in Belgrade, Serbia, will be a key event for identifying new talent.
Victor Oladipo's Comeback Attempt
Victor Oladipo, the two-time All-Star, is working towards an NBA return after a series of injuries. His recent private workout in Las Vegas impressed several NBA and European teams, signaling a potential comeback. Oladipo remains optimistic about his ability to contribute to any team in the league.
Lauri Markkanen's Future with the Utah Jazz
Despite trade rumors, the Utah Jazz are committed to keeping Lauri Markkanen as a key player in their future core. Markkanen's recent contract extension reflects the Jazz's belief in his potential to help the team become competitive again.
Josh Giddey's Contract Negotiations
The Chicago Bulls and Josh Giddey continue to negotiate a new contract. While Giddey seeks a significant annual salary, the Bulls are leveraging their cap space to secure a more team-friendly deal. Both sides remain optimistic about reaching an agreement.
Indiana Pacers' Rebuilding Phase
Following the loss of key players Tyrese Haliburton and Myles Turner, the Indiana Pacers are focusing on rebuilding their team. Andrew Nembhard and Bennedict Mathurin are expected to play crucial roles in the Pacers' offense next season.
NBA Expansion Considerations
As the NBA considers expansion, with Las Vegas and Seattle as potential destinations, the possibility of a team moving to the Eastern Conference to balance the leagues is being discussed. This change could have significant implications for the competitive landscape of the NBA.
